Russia has denied it plans to attack Ukraine, but has also demanded Ukraine not be allowed to join NATO, with Putin claiming he’d be worried about weapons systems being deployed near Russia if Ukraine is allowed to join the organization.

Europe surpasses 75 million COVID-19 cases amid spread of OmicronEurope crossed 75 million coronavirus cases on Friday, according to a Reuters tally, as the region braces for the new Omicron variant at a time when hospitals in some countries are already strained by the current surge. Over 15 countries in Europe have reported confirmed cases of the new variant that has rattled financial markets. The European Union's public health agency said on Thursday that the Omicron variant could be responsible for more than half of all COVID-19 infections in Europe within a few months.
